Retirement Plan

Full-time employees are eligible to participate in the Heritage Hall TIAA-CREF Retirement Plan, administered by the Teachers’ Insurance and Annuity Association in New York. 
The Plan may provide benefits upon retirement, death, or termination of employment. 

Employees may begin plan participation after reaching 23 years of age and after completing one year of full-time employment. 

Each year, Heritage Hall will contribute a sum equal to 5% of salary on behalf of all plan participants. After an employee reaches age 40, the School will additionally match the employee's contribution, dollar for dollar, up to an additional 5%. 

Employees become vested at the rate of 25% per year of service, reaching full vestment in their fourth year at Heritage Hall.
